Wearing high-waisted bottoms can help visually shorten your legs by creating the illusion of a longer torso. Opting for straight or wide-leg pants can also balance your proportions. Additionally, choosing tops with horizontal lines or details near your waist can draw attention away from your legs.

Yes, eyelashes can become shorter and thinner as a person ages due to the natural aging process, hormonal changes, and decreased production of collagen which affects hair growth. Additionally, factors like poor diet, stress, and certain medical conditions can also contribute to eyelash thinning and shortening with age.
The four main types of bones are long bones (e.g. femur), short bones (e.g. carpals), flat bones (e.g. sternum), and irregular bones (e.g. vertebrae). Each type serves a specific function in the body's musculoskeletal system.
